Exotica-themed restaurant serves an array of approachable Southeast Asian dishes.. The décor is Pier One meets Indiana Jones, with birdcages suspended from the ceiling, wood floors and a notable presence of bamboo and rattan. The upstairs mezzanine and main room are filled with couples meeting up after work, tourists and large groups celebrating birthdays or co-worker send-offs. The ambient noise is surprisingly low considering how packed it can get. Service is brisk and efficient. The primarily small plates menu is a globetrotting monsoon of Eastern spices and flavors. A refreshing starter is the Burmese green papaya salad, while the signature Indonesian corn fritter is a bit heavier. Meats are expertly handled, especially the succulent mango-glazed Thai ribs. There are numerous grilled items, like marinated ahi or a steak satay that's juicy but a touch pricey considering the smallish portion. The banana fritter is an island-inspired finish.
